Blog Abdul Mannan Sya'roni

selamat berjumpa kembali dengan saya di Blog Abdul Mannan Sya'roni,
Pada kesempatan kali ini saya akan membagikan sebuat tutorial yang mungkin anda cari, YUP yaitu cara membuat post viewer pada postingan wordpress,


Tutorial dibawah ini telah ditester di Jasa Pembuatan Website Desain Profesional




jadi bagi anda yang menggunakan CMS wordpress untuk membuat website atau blog, berikut cara membuat set post viewer tanpa plugin,

silahkan masuk ke admin area anda, cari Appearance => Editor
cari file functions.php

namun pada versi wordpress yg sekarang 4.9.4 yang terupdate sekitar akhir pekan bulan desember 2018, masih belum dapat mengedit menggunakan editor wordpress karena CMS update masih Beta,

namun pada CMS WP yg versi lama pati bisa dengan syarat diizinkan oleh Hosting anda wordpress mengakses FTP.

Jika kebetulan tidak bisa menggunakan Editor Bawaaan Wordpress maka anda harus masuk Ke Cpanel Hosting anda cari di dalam File Themes yg anda pakai file Functions.php

Buka dan Edit, setelah berhasil membuka maka masukkan kode dibawah ini kedalam file tersebut di paling bawah, sebelum tag ?> (jika line paling bawah ada penutup tag ?> ), jika di line bawah tidak ada tag ?> maka cukup tambahkan saja kodenya, Oke

// function to display number of posts.

function getPostViews($postID){

  $count_key = 'post_views_count';

  $count = get_post_meta($postID, $count_key, true);

  if($count==''){

    delete_post_meta($postID, $count_key);

    add_post_meta($postID, $count_key, '0');

    return "0 View";

  }else{

    return $count.' Views';

  }

}


// function to count views.

function setPostViews($postID) {

  $count_key = 'post_views_count';

  $count = get_post_meta($postID, $count_key, true);

  if($count==''){

    $count = 0;

    delete_post_meta($postID, $count_key);

    add_post_meta($postID, $count_key, '0');

  }else{

    $count++;

    update_post_meta($postID, $count_key, $count);

  }

}


setelah anda tambahkan kode diatas silahkan anda simpan, sekarang anda buka file single.php
masukkan kode berikut :

<?php setPostViews(get_the_ID()); ?>

kode diatas ini untuk men set Post view jika ada yg mengunjungi atau membacanya.


setelah itu untuk melihat hasil Viewer Post, maka tambahkan kode berikut ini :

<?php echo getPostViews(get_the_ID()); ?>

kode diaas ini untuk menampilkan hasil set viewer, silahkan anda taruh dimana saja yg anda sukai, baik di Home, Archives, ategori, Single Post dll

perlu diperhatikan, untuk menampilkan data ini harus ada di dalam Looping Post wordpress karena disini membutuhkan KODE ID dari setiap post anda, jika ditempatkan diluar Loop (Perulangan Postingan) maka akan mengakibatkan Error dan False dalam artian Gagal menampilkan konten post.

Oke sobat mungkin pada tutorial kali ini hanya itu saja, semoga bermanfaat,

GOOD LUCK
Praktek dan Kembangkan

Komentar

Komentar kotor, menyinggung dan mengandung karakter yang tidak diperkenankan oleh admin akan di hapus dari Blog, Terimakasih!